Mick Tinker posted “Just realised that my first triathlon was half a lifetime ago in 1984. It was a fairly new sport then and not regulated. Mine was at Aireborough sports centre and was a 1000m-ish swim, then a 9 mile run, then an 18 mile bike ride (which was 3 laps down through Esholt sewage works and up Rawdon Bank). we were given 10 minutes for each transition so time to change and have tea and biscuits. I came 35th of 70 in 1984 and 27th of 79 in 1985. a certain Steve O'Callaghan came 6th and Yvonne Bisset was 3rd lady”

Sad news - former VS member Henry Lang killed in cycle accident

 

Former VS member Bill Murphy emailed me with a link to the BBC website

 

A cyclist who was killed after being hit by a dust cart in Richmond has been named as Henry Lang. The 40-year-old IT specialist died yesterday, July 22, a day after being hit by a dust cart in Kew Foot Road at the junction with St John’s Grove by the A316 in Richmond. Mr Lang suffered major head injuries and was airlifted to the Royal London Hospital but doctors could not save him. The business analyst, from Twickenham, was working at Photobox at the time of his death and previously worked for the Metropolitan Police as a business analyst. Mr Lang is the second cyclist to be killed this week after a 25-year-old man was hit by a car in Merton. Detective Sergeant John Hartfree, of the serious collision investigation unit based at Merton, said: “The road would have been very busy at the time of the collision and I believe that a number of people would have seen the incident. The driver of the dust cart stopped at the scene but was not arrested. The investigation continues

 

I’ve looked through the VS website and found that Henry joined us in July 2001 and very quickly improved such that in 2002 he ran 1:22:19 in the Leeds Half, 1:00:58 in the Otley 10 (11th overall), and was joint winner of the VS Grand Prix! He also ran in relays - was part of our inaugural Bradford Millennium Way team (we recced leg 2 together but he ran in the A team, I ran in the mixed), in a VS team that finished 4th in the Danefield Relay and in a VS team that finished 6th in the Leeds Country Way.  For more results from 2002, see http://valleystriders.org.uk/vsnews.htm

 

A couple of Striders have mentioned that they particularly remember Henry because he used to wear very long shorts (almost to his knee) when the prevailing fashion (for men) was very skimpy as can be seen on photos on the website.
